Myco flora associated with agents of tracheo mycosis of the tomato

Chaetomium spp. Stachybotrys atra, Melanospora zamiae are specific fungi of decaying tissue of tomato colonized by wilt pathogens. The early presence of the first 2 fungi in the plant could efficiently stop the saprophytic development of Verticillium dahliae. Melanospora, which is constantly associated with the Fusarium wilt fungi, seems to follow a vascular route.
